Updated CryoTanks to 1.2.0
- Fixed a localization typo
- Tuned VAB UI part tooltip fields for boiloff module
- Reworked textures of foil tanks to match Restock and Near Future Construction
- Normalized grey to be similar to all my other mods
- Recompressed all textures with better compression algorithm
-
Added optional simplistic draft Liquid Methane support
- Slightly cryogenic (1/10th the boiloff rate of Liquid Hydrogen)
- Similar mass ratio to Liquid Fuel (9)
- Higher cost ratio compared to Liquid Fuel (0.12 vs 0.1)
- Enabled by declaring any MM patch with :FOR[CryoTanksMethalox] or including a folder in GameData called CryoTanksMethalox
- Soft-deprecated entire old set of CryoEngines parts; they are replaced but invisible so people have time to adapt
-
New 0.625m engine:
- CR-10A 'Stromboli' Cryogenic Rocket Engine: Sustainer engine based on updated hypothetical DC-X RL-10-A5. 0.625m, Boattail and Compact variants
-
Revised 1.25m engines
- CR-2 'Vesuvius' Cryogenic Rocket Engine: Sustainer engine based on Ariane Vulcain 2. 1.25m, Boattail and Compact variants. Similar to old Volcano.
- CE-10 'Hecate' Cryogenic Rocket Engine: Vacuum engine with extensible nozzle based on RL-10-C2. 1.25m and Compact variants. Similar to old Chelyabinsk.
-
New 1.875m engines
- CR-0120 'Erebus' Cryogenic Rocket Engine: Sustainer engine based on Energia RD-0120. 1.875m, Boattail and Compact variants.
- CE-60 'Pavonis' Cryogenic Rocket Engine: Vacuum engine with extensible nozzle based on unflown RL-60. 1.875 and Compact variants.
-
Revised 2.5m engines
- CR-9 'Fuji' Cryogenic Rocket Engine: Sustainer engine based on JAXA LE-9. 2.5m, Boattail and Compact variants. Similar to old Odin.
- CE-2X 'Ulysses' Cryogenic Rocket Engine: Vacuum engine based on Constellation J2-X. 2.5m and Compact variants. Similar to old Tunguska.
-
Revised 3.75m engines
- CR-68 'Etna' Cryogenic Rocket Engine: Sustainer engine based on Delta IV RS-68. 3.75m, Boattail and Compact variants. Similar to old Mars.
- CE-602 'Tharsis' Cryogenic Engine Cluster: Vacuum engine cluster with extensible nozzles based on alternate Constellation upper stage option. 3.75m and Compact variants.
- Restock style engine effect model and emissives propagated to all new parts
- New plumes for all engines
- RealPlume support for new plumes, courtesy of Zorg
- Slightly tuned most revised engines in terms of mass, thrust and Isp compared to their predecessors
- CryoEnginesLFO Extras package has been tuned to match the new content (typically 70s of Isp loss)
-
New Extras package: CryoEnginesRestock
- Adapts the appropriate ReStock and ReStockPlus engines into cryogenic engines (Vector, Mammoth, Rhino, Skipper, Corgi, Skiff/Caravel) with significant balance changes
- Changes the plume for the Rhino, Skiff/Caravel and Skipper to be appropriately cryogenic
